About Billy Button Early Learning

Billy Button Early Learning – South Morang


We are an innovative, nature-inspired early learning centre that provides high-quality education and care for children from birth to kindergarten. We take a holistic approach to learning and development, offering inclusive early learning and kindergarten programs that support children of all abilities to grow, learn, and thrive.

Approved Program
Our curriculum is derived from the National and State Early Years Learning Frameworks


Experienced Educators
Our team is a culturally diverse group of experienced educators who are passionate about early childhood education and care.


Outdoor Environment
Nature is central to our philosophy at Billy Button Early Learning and is thoughtfully reflected throughout our purpose-built environments. Our outdoor spaces are carefully designed using natural, durable materials that create warmth and invite exploration and discovery. From handcrafted timber play equipment to open, engaging play areas, children are supported to enjoy meaningful outdoor experiences.

Our outdoor environment was purposefully designed to compliment the surrounding landscape of the adjoining Pipe Track Park. This is a great opportunity to feel a sense of connection with the local community.


Rooms at South Morang
Our rooms have been specifically designed to bring nature and a sense of home together to create an enjoyable, happy place where children can live, laugh, and learn. The rooms have been constructed in a way to meet children’s developmental milestones as we watch them grow from 6 weeks old to 6 years old.

Programs

Programs

Community Connections Program: with a strong sense of community and nature, the children will take part in community walks, teddy bear picnics at the nearby park, bush walks and explorations.

Music & dance program: this will give children an opportunity to express themselves in a different language that brings out creativity and imagination. The program brings together different cultures, instruments and musical genres and will build into an end of year celebration concert.

Sports program: the centre has partnered with Little Sports Heroes to run a weekly sports program. It will give children the opportunity to learn a variety of new skills whilst having fun.

Garden to kitchen program: this will teach children where food comes from and how it gets to their table every day. They will learn how to connect with nature through the vegetable garden and composting system as they assist in the care towards the environment. It will encourage healthy eating habits as they are introduced to food preparation and cooking opportunities with the centre chef.

About the curriculum

About the curriculum

At Billy Button Early Learning Centre, the rooms have been specifically designed to bring nature and a sense of home together to create an enjoyable, happy place where children can live, laugh, and learn. The rooms have been constructed in a way to meet children’s developmental milestones.

Sugar Glider

6 weeks to 15 months old 

Infants at this age are just starting out in their development as they work towards building their basic gross motor and fine motor skills. Multi-sensory development with a ‘sense of touch’ is important to creating those special bonds between infant and carer. Each child’s routine is catered for in collaboration with their families to provide a safe and consistent environment. 

Fantail

12 months to 2 years old

Children at this age are moving from being infants into becoming toddlers. They begin to build more on their gross and fine motor skills, communication becomes more vocal, and their social interactions form more cooperative play. 

Fairy Wren

2 years to 3 years old

Toddlers are at one of the most important ages for emotional development. This is when they are processing many emotions whilst they are learning about other people’s feelings. The educators work with each child through their emotions and develop strategies with them as they learn how to express themselves verbally.

Growling Grass Frog

2.5 years to 3.5 years old

As toddlers continue to grow, they will develop their verbal skills by using short sentences to communicate. They become more independent with their basic needs and wants as they work towards toilet training, dressing themselves, learning social interactions with peers and more.

King Parrot

3 years to 4 years old 

This is the age where the children will become more interested in playing and making friends with other children. Imagination comes out more as they explore different dramatic play opportunities that are created by their current interests. The educators will encourage each child’s imagination to extend their ideas, as they interact with them in group sessions and one on one. 

Blue-tongued Lizard

4 years to 6 years old 

This is a critical time for children as they work towards preparing themselves to enter the next stage of their schooling. School readiness is a priority at the centre, and the team of educators plan holistic programs to produce structured routines and flexible learning environments that extend on verbal communication, fine and gross motor skills, social interactions and more.

Health & nutrition

Health & nutrition

At Billy Button Early Learning, the team believe that children gain a healthy mind and body through exercise and the types of foods they eat. A nutritional menu has been specifically designed, to cater for each child’s needs taking into consideration any dietary requirements, religious requirements, and medical conditions. 

The children enjoy mealtimes as opportunities to interact in a family setting whilst they learn the value of healthy eating, having their peers and educators role model good eating habits.
